Chibi Finance disappears with $1 million on Arbitrum in suspected “rug pull”

The decentralized finance (DeFi) space has suffered yet another setback as Chibi Finance, an innovative project running on Arbitrum, has been accused of absconding with approximately $1 million in customer funds. This disconcerting incident is a stark reminder that extensive research and caution are vital in the DeFi domain.

Leading blockchain security firm PeckShield conducted an extensive on-chain investigation, revealing that Chibi Finance’s cold storage had been compromised, resulting in the theft of 555 ether (ETH) from the platform. The project team allegedly converted users’ staked tokens on the Arbitrum network into Ether to facilitate the illicit transfer.

To mask their trail, the Chibi Finance team astutely utilized the renowned Ethereum mixing service, Tornado Cash, which obfuscates transaction origins and complicates tracking efforts. The integration of Tornado Cash significantly hampered investigators’ attempts to trace the stolen funds and apprehend the perpetrators.

Adding to the intrigue, the project’s team suddenly vanished from the digital landscape, leaving users perplexed and disheartened. Online profiles associated with Chibi Finance, including their official website, chibi.finance, Twitter account, and Telegram channel have all been taken down. This unexpected disappearance has raised serious concerns about the project’s legitimacy and deepened the mystery surrounding the incident.
